What Is a 3d Children's Pen? An Overview of Its Features and Functionality
Understanding the Device
The 3d children's pen is a handheld device that allows children to draw and create three-dimensional objects freehand, much like a traditional pen or marker but with the power of 3D printing. Typically, these pens use thermoplastic filament — a safe, non-toxic material that heats and cools rapidly — to extrude material layer by layer, enabling children to build structures with depth and dimension directly in the air or on surfaces.
Key Features of the Best 3d Children's Pens
- Safety First: Made with child-safe materials, automatic shut-off features, and non-toxic filaments to ensure safe usage.
- Ease of Use: Ergonomically designed with simple controls suitable for children of various age groups, usually from age 6 and up.
- Adjustable Temperature and Speed: Allows customization for different filaments and detailed work.
- Variety of Filament Colors: Supports multiple colors and effects, fostering vivid and colorful designs.
- Portability and Battery Power: Wireless operation for convenience and ease of use anywhere.

Choosing the Right 3d Children's Pen: Factors to Consider
Safety and Certifications
Ensure the device adheres to international safety standards, featuring non-toxic, BPA-free filaments and automatic shut-off mechanisms to prevent overheating or injury.
Ease of Operation
Look for user-friendly interfaces, simple controls, and ergonomic designs tailored for children. Adjustable settings should be intuitive and accessible for beginners.
Compatibility and Filament Options
Opt for pens compatible with a variety of filament colors and types, including PLA, ABS, and specialty filaments for different effects. Availability of refill packs and ease of filament loading are important considerations.
Durability and Portability
The device should withstand young users' handling and be lightweight for portability, allowing creativity anywhere—at home, school, or on the go.
